Stickann is a German ready to wear brand that provides designs focusing on gender fluidity.
Focusing on pattern making which works against a binary gender mindset, Stickann provides pieces, that include all types of genders and bodies by also focusing on sustainability at the same time.
Its value chain from production to logistics is all made in Germany, while the supply of raw materials is divided between Germany and Italy.
Stickann focuses on the use of nature based fabrics and resources such as linen and silk
The brand uses deadstock fabrics for samples and tries to use them for details as well as lining. It also tries to reuse fabrics of earlier collections and integrate them in upcoming collections.
The brand has visited almost all of its suppliers in order to be aware of its workers conditions.
In terms of development activity, Stickann uses part of the materials from its old stock for the prototypes production.
Between 40 and 60% of its packaging is recycled.
The brand is equipped with an evacuation plan in its company building.
Stickann allows smart working to its employees in order to better balance their private life and work.
It also provides various benefits to its employees (such as parking for bike, transportation for free to reach the office, lunch meal for free....)
The brand organizes meetings or webinars about sustainable topics such as gender equality awareness issues.
Stickann uses renewable energy.
Stickann shares its knowledge to customers on how to treat the pieces to make them last as long as possible.

Is your communication properly inspired by your level of sustainability? What should you do to improve it? Sustainability is an indispensable need. Our communication, in general, is more about the design and the aesthetics of our brand as well as the gender inclusive mindest that we want to spread. Nevertheless we could implement our sustainable aspects in order to show that sustainability and design can be combined. |
2 |
What does sustainable fashion mean to you? -Durability. -Adopting fair work practices. -Minimal use of chemical elements. -Fair worker conditions. -Sharing the business benefit with the community. |
3 |
What would you like your target audience's priorities to be? -Quality/Design. -Brand identity. -Sustainability. |
4 |
Where do you produce your items? We focus on a domestic sourcing and production which means that we produce everything in our own atelier or in productions in Germany that we corporate with. To keep distances short we just order fabrics from Europe or Germany. |
